- Angel OrtegaJul 30, 2024 · 2 years agoAnother way to maintain normal GPU temperatures while trading cryptocurrencies is to monitor your GPU temperatures regularly. Use software like MSI Afterburner or GPU-Z to keep an eye on the temperatures. If you notice that the temperatures are consistently high, you can try adjusting the fan speed or applying thermal paste to improve heat dissipation. It's important to take proactive measures to prevent overheating and ensure the longevity of your GPU.
